| package com.android.internal.telephony; |
| |
| import com.android.internal.telephony.IThirdPartyCallListener; |
| import com.android.internal.telephony.IThirdPartyCallSendDtmfCallback; |
| |
| /** |
| * Interface sent to ThirdPartyCallListener.onCallProviderAttached. This is used to control an |
| * outgoing or incoming call. |
| */ |
| oneway interface IThirdPartyCallProvider { |
| /** |
| * Mutes or unmutes the call. |
| */ |
| void mute(boolean shouldMute); |
| |
| /** |
| * Ends the current call. If this is an unanswered incoming call then the call is rejected (for |
| * example, a notification is sent to a server that the user declined the call). |
| */ |
| void hangup(); |
| |
| /** |
| * Accepts the incoming call. |
| */ |
| void incomingCallAccept(); |
| |
| /** |
| * Sends the given DTMF code. The code can be '0'-'9', 'A'-'D', '#', or '*'. |
| */ |
| void sendDtmf(char c, IThirdPartyCallSendDtmfCallback callback); |
| } |
